The GE Panametrics AquaTrans AT600 ultrasonic flow meter has no moving parts and requires minimal maintenance. An on-board microprocessor uses patented correlation transit-time technology for long-term, drift-free operation. Automatic adjustment to changing fluid properties and dynamically configured operating software simplifies programming.

The accuracy in field calibration is ±0.5% assuming installation is a fully developed, symmetrical flow profile (typically 10 diameters upstream and 5 diameters downstream of straight pipe run). Final installation accuracy is a function of multiple factors including fluid, temperature range, pipe centricity, and other influences.

Clamp-on transducers offer maximum convenience, flexibility and a low installation cost compared to traditional flow metering technologies. With proper installation, clamp-on transducers provide better than 1% of reading accuracy in most applications.
The AT600 is designed specifically for water and wastewater applications in full pipes, but works with various acoustically conductive liquids. Fluid types include most clean liquids and many liquids with small amounts of entrained solids or gas bubbles.

              Fluid types
              • Liquids: acoustically conductive fluids, including most clean liquids, and many liquids with small amounts of entrained solids or gas bubbles.
              • Flow measurement: Patented Correlation Transit-TimeTM  mode
              • Pipe sizes: 0.5 to 300 in. (15 to 7600 mm)
              • Pipe materials: All metals and most plastics. Consult Baker Huges for concrete, composite materials, and highly corroded or lined pipes.
              Accuracy
              • ±1% of reading in application, ≥2 in. (50 mm) pipe and >1 ft/s (0.3 m/s) velocity
              • ±2% of reading in application, <2 in. (50 mm) pipe and >1 ft/s (0.3 m/s) velocity
              • ±0.5% in field calibration
              • Installation assumes a fully developed, symmetrical flow profile (typically 10 diameters upstream and 5 diameters downstream of straight pipe run). Final installation accuracy is a function of multiple factors including fluid, temperature range, pipe centricity and others.
              • Calibration: All meters are water calibrated and delivered with a traceable calibration certificate.
              • Repeatability: ±0.2% of reading Range (bidirectional)-40 to 40 ft/s (-12.19 to 12.19 m/s)
              • Rangability (overall): 400:1
              • Measurement parameters:  Velocity, Volumetric, and totalized flow
              Electronics
              • Enclosure: Epoxy-coated aluminum weatherproof Type 4X/IP67
              • Dimensions: 6.6 x 5.0 x 2.4 in. (168 x 128 x 61 mm)
              • Weight: 3.5 lb/1.5 kg Channels One channel
              • Display: Graphic LCD (128 x 64 pixels)
              • Keypad: Six-button keypad for full functionality operation
              • Error display indicator: Green or red light
              Power supplies:
              • Standard: 85 to 265 VAC, 50/60 Hz
              • Optional: 12 to 28 VDC, ± 5%
              Power consumption:
              • 10 Watts in-rush
              • 5 Watts normal operation
              • Operating temperature: -4°F to 131°F (–20°C to 55°C)
              • Storage temperature: –40°F to 158°F (–40°C to 70°C)
              Outputs (based on configuration):
              • 4-20 mA (24VDC powered, 600Ω maximum load,   1500 VDC isolation)
              • Frequency, pulse, alarm (Passive output, 100 VDC, 1 A/1 W maximum, 1500 VDC isolation)
              • HART (FSK modulation, category flow, protocol version 7.5, device revision 2, MFG ID 157, device type code 127, number of device variables 34)
              • Modbus/RS485 (Half-duplex, 1500 VDC isolation)
              • Note: Analog outputs are Namur NE43 compliant.
              • Certification: CE, UL, CSA, (MCert approval pending)
              • Clamp-on ultrasonic flow transducers
              Temperature ranges:
              • Standard: -40 to 302°F (-40 to 150°C)
              • Optional: -328 to 752°F (-200 to 400°C) See specific transducer for exact temperature range.
              • Mounting fixture Anodized aluminum with stainless steel strapping
              Couplant
              • Standard: Solid couplant
              • Optional: Liquid couplant
              Rating Standard:
              • General purpose (IP66 or IP68)
              • Note: See specific transducer model for exact rating.
